Abstract
⺠We investigate an apoA-I receptor in the CNS and the mechanism of action. ⺠We show that ABCA1 is an apoA-I-binding protein of astrocytes. ⺠ABCA1 enhances the association of CLPP and microtubules through the interaction with PL-Cγ.
